Education
Families considering a move to Stoutsville will want to know about the local schools. Stoutsville is served by the Amanda-Clearcreek Local School District, which is committed to providing a quality education to students of all ages. The district operates several schools in the area, including:
The Amanda-Clearcreek Local School District is known for its dedicated teachers, rigorous curriculum, and supportive learning environment.
